After starting up, hit ctrl+shift+escape to bring up task manager. From the
applications tab, click on 'new task'. Type regedit and click ok. Click
continue at the uac prompt. Expand the branches of the registry to reach
this key:
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ows NT\CurrentVersion\Winlogon
Click on the key, the check the right pane for a string called shell. Double
click this string, replace the contents with:
explorer.exe
Click ok, then close the registry editor and task manager and restart the
machine. See if this helps.
